The Royal Flying Doctor Service (Queensland Section) (RFDS) has a unique opportunity for a passionate individual to join our Central West and Outback Mental Health Team as a Support Worker in our Parenting program, known internally as a Parenting Program Worker. In this role, you will be dedicated to strengthening the bond between children and parents.

In this non-clinical role, you will support the local delivery of the Circle of Security Parenting (COSP) Program in Longreach and the surrounding Shires, including Winton, Barcaldine, Blackall/Tambo, Boulia and Diamantina. You will be supported to undertake formal facilitator training so that you can facilitate the COSP program. The COSP program supports families in developing parenting skills, emotional attunement, and secure attachment relationships with their children. RFDS Longreach

Since 2004, RFDS (Queensland Section) has provided mental health support to people in Longreach and the surrounding areas. The service operates on a hub-and-spoke model, with the Longreach office serving as the primary base for clinicians delivering services in nearby communities. The team consists of multi-disciplinary professionals, including psychologists, social workers, mental health nurses, and occupational therapists, providing psychological therapies, counselling services, and mental health education and promotion.

About Royal Flying Doctor Service

Port Hedland, WA, Australia

The Royal Flying Doctor Service is one of the largest and most comprehensive aeromedical organisations in the world, providing extensive primary health care and 24-hour emergency service to people over an area of 7.3 million square kilometres.

Delivered by a dedicated team of professionals, using the latest in aviation, medical and communications technology, and supported by a vast number of volunteers and supporters, the RFDS is vital for those that live, work and travel in rural and remote Australia.
